VEGF165, His & Avi, Human
VEGF165, His & Avi, Human

Item number: GSC-Z05953-100

Vascular endothelial growth factor (VEGF or VEGF-A), also known as vascular permeability factor (VPF), is a potent mediator of both angiogenesis and vasculogenesis in the fetus and adult. VEGF165 appears to be the most abundant and potent isoform, followed by VEGF121 and VEGF189.

E8L, His, Monkeypox virus
E8L, His, Monkeypox virus

Item number: GSC-Z05976-100

E8L is an important protein that mediates the invasion of monkeypox virus into host cells. In the process of invading and completing replication, E8L acts as a surface-binding protein of mature virion and can bind to chondroitin sulfate on the cell surface, so that the virus can attach to target cells.
